Short Path Distillery is a craft distiller founded in Everett, Massachusetts in 2015. This community-focused local business now offering more that more than 25 spirits that showcase their unique approach to spirit development and commitment to quality and community.
“Short path” is a term of art in the distillary world, but it also represents a commitment to sourcing local incredients. Just as birds typically choose the shortest path between two points, Short Path holds that the shorter the path between ingredients and product produces the more rewarding result. (LINK)
The Mystic River Watershed Association (MyRWA) builds solutions so that all people across the watershed, no matter who you are or where you live, have safe and easy access to nature and a healthy environment. MyRWA is rooted in science and the understanding of environmental injustices. We believe access to information and opportunities to learn about the natural world empower us all to work together for a better future in the Mystic. (LINK)
